Thursday came no matter how much Britta dreaded it. Her tabby cat wound his way around her legs, purring. “Norman, I wish you could go to the board meeting for me.” She rubbed behind his ears, and Norman mewed. Whenever she thought of Armand’s allergic reaction to her cat, she cringed. “I wonder if Milo likes cats,” she said, but then shook her head. Every time she turned around, her thoughts were connecting with Milo, wondering what he would think of a song she heard on the radio, or the books she’d just ordered for the library. Britta resolved to stay focused and get through the day. She set up for the board meeting, pushing out every thought of Milo and creating more checklists of things that needed to be done before the Harvest Hurrah.
